Transaction d0de0f6242d52b7e90a56e4a9b905b20194f2d4d93e8bedd4573599704ea8544

block
0827fd4355305bb0f052e363e51f1cfd9bb77d18ceacc22163887a19cdb68aec

1 Input

23 Outputs